Right, so ignoring the killjoys.


Depending on how much you're willing to spend/what bitz you have available/how in depth you want this conversion to be, a good place to start would probably be with one of the existing sorcerer models. I'd go with this guy since he's already got a cool pose. Then, if it were me building him, i'd replace the sword with a chain axe and then lop off his head and replace it with either...

Spoiler:
this head. (the bare head with the horns)


or this head.

Depending on what upgrades you plan on giving him, you might look to the possessed kit. Demonic wings, hoofed legs for a more bestial appearance, etc.


Of course, if you don't want to do to much converting then maybe take someone like Huron Blackheart. Since he's already kind of sorcerish looking, give him a slightly more khorny head and he's good to go.

Another easy conversion would be Draznicht from the Dark Vengeance kit. He's got 3 eyes, kinda khorne looking already. Again, just replace the mace head with a chain axe head and he's good to go.

 Powerfisting wrote:


Dam. Any ideas where to start for a base for a conversion like this? I'm still gravitating toward Valkya the Bloody, and just tying her down, like she's trying to fly away but can't. Also, while I'm at it, does anyone know if its easy to get/ sculpt chains for this purpose?


Well it mostly depends on how you want to portrait your psyker and how much money/time you want to throw at this project. You could start with a robed body and cut tears into the fabrik, get the tzeentch sorcerer head from the standard csm box and whatever arms you find suitable for reposing.
And if you want to keep Valkya the Bloody as a base model maybe add some parchments to her or scrolls and books. There are some fantasy bits that work well for that, as well as scrolls in the black templar bit sprue.

Sculpting acceptable chains onto a surface isn't too hard. But I recommend a few tries before adding them to the model.
If you want free hanging ones either get some from existing kits like various chaos decoration bits. Or simply use small actual chains that you can simply glue to your model. They stay relatively stable once covered in super glue. I did this a few times myself already. Just put them somewhere where there is less risk of the glue breaking and you are golden.
Alternatively Zinge has some flexible resin ones to use: http://zinge.co.uk/index.php?route=product/product&path=17&product_id=263 I never used those. But I believe you just heat them and bent them into shape. I however don't know if any of those approaches can hold up a model on its own. You are probably better off hiding an actual wire somewhere.
